Output e4fbeeffc2a24759dc0216dfdf2c6d6fc16162fe90bb32bbf29b2acfbf0707cd:1

value
29868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3922fc18ab87c4ae42cab4a9a60848b4cac9430 OP_EQUAL
address
3PtuFNsVstqzT6TfXUpYwNbgJaQi1aRF1V
transaction
e4fbeeffc2a24759dc0216dfdf2c6d6fc16162fe90bb32bbf29b2acfbf0707cd
confirmations
550325
spent
true